buzz bomb

NOUN
  1. a small jet-propelled winged missile that carries a bomb

How To Use buzz bomb In A Sentence

  • The device was the notorious doodlebug, or buzz bomb.
  • The small London row house where Edith, Muriel's father's sister lived had been hit by a buzz bomb and the second floor was unlivable.
  • But the rocket, known to the British as the "buzz bomb" or the "doodlebug," was also easily spotted and comparatively slow, making it vulnerable to antiaircraft fire and enemy fighters. June 13, 1944: V-1 Rocket Ushers in a New Kind of Warfare
  • Londoners under attack would come to know it as the doodlebug or buzz bomb, so called for the mechanical hum it made before dropping on its target.
